Seong Shan Yap is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Mechanics of Materials. According to data from OpenAlex, Seong Shan Yap has authored 70 papers receiving a total of 600 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Electrical and Electronic Engineering, 34 papers in Materials Chemistry and 21 papers in Mechanics of Materials. Recurrent topics in Seong Shan Yap’s work include Diamond and Carbon-based Materials Research (17 papers), Laser-induced spectroscopy and plasma (13 papers) and Organic Light-Emitting Diodes Research (13 papers). Seong Shan Yap is often cited by papers focused on Diamond and Carbon-based Materials Research (17 papers), Laser-induced spectroscopy and plasma (13 papers) and Organic Light-Emitting Diodes Research (13 papers). Seong Shan Yap collaborates with scholars based in Malaysia, Norway and United States. Seong Shan Yap's co-authors include Teck‐Yong Tou, S. L. Yap, Chen Hon Nee, Kwai Lin Thong, György Sáfrán, Huan‐Cheng Chang, Teng Sian Ong, Seik-Weng Ng, Yoke Khin Yap and Zsolt E. Horváth and has published in prestigious journals such as Scientific Reports, Physical Chemistry Chemical Physics and Archives of Biochemistry and Biophysics.
